Understanding 10 x 1 Self Tapping Screws

When we talk about 10 x 1 self tapping screws, we're referring to a specific size that's often in demand for projects requiring precision and reliability. Their ability to tap their own threads while being driven into material is what makes them so indispensable. From my own experience, their use in metal and sometimes wood opens up opportunities where traditional screws might falter.

One common misunderstanding is assuming all self tapping screws are the same. I remember a time when I mistakenly used a different size, leading to stripped threads that needed a complete do-over. It's crucial to match the screw size to the material and project requirements.

These screws excel in tasks where pre-drilled holes aren't feasible. The first time I used them on a steel framework, the ease with which they created threads was a revelation. However, the right tool makes a difference. A good quality drill with the proper bit ensures the screw performs optimally without unnecessary exertion.

The Role of Material and Coating

Material choice for these screws is essential. Stainless steel is my go-to for corrosive environments, while carbon steel suits indoor applications. I learned this the hard way during an outdoor installation when regular steel screws began rusting much sooner than expected. Lesson learned—choose material wisely.

Then there's the coating. Zinc-plated screws offer an extra layer of protection and, from what I've observed, they also look aesthetically pleasing. This might seem minor, but has a significant impact on the overall quality perception of your work. Practical Applications and Insights

Applications are where the rubber meets the road, or rather where the screw meets the surface. We've talked about metal, but there are unexpected uses in plastics and even composites. I stumbled upon this when working on a boat restoration project, where these screws provided just the right grip and hold without cracking the surface.

While they are versatile, alignment is key. Misalignment can lead to breakage or weak joints. For novices, this isn't always intuitive. I've spent hours on projects before I realized that a simple alignment tool could save time and frustration.

Not all surfaces are forgiving, and sometimes pilot holes are still necessary, despite the screws' self tapping nature. This is especially true for very hard materials. I've found marking the entry point ensures accuracy and efficiency.

Comparing with Other Fasteners

When comparing 10 x 1 self tapping screws with other fasteners, the ability to create threads while securing the material without needing a nut is unbeatable for certain projects. Their advantage is most evident in tight spaces where maneuverability is limited.

In contrast, traditional bolts and nuts might offer strength in certain applications but can be cumbersome. The adjustments needed for these can lead to a larger toolset. In contrast, these screws streamline the process significantly.

I've spoken with colleagues who swear by alternative fasteners, yet, after practical comparisons, many find themselves gravitating back—especially when speed and simplicity are at a premium.

Challenges and Troubleshooting

While these screws generally offer ease of use, they're not without challenges. Overdriving is a common issue, often leading to stripped heads or damaged materials. A subtle hand and a good clutch setting on your drill can mitigate this problem. Trust me, practice can save you from plenty of headaches.

Material brittleness, particularly in older plywood or thin metals, sometimes poses issues. I recall a situation where a softer metal deformed, causing alignment problems which were only remedied with re-alignment and a gentler approach.

Even seasoned workers encounter challenges. A common trick is using soap or wax to aid in smoother insertion, which has helped me sufficiently during difficult applications. Sometimes, these small tricks make a world of difference in project success.
